In a kingdom where magic flows through conduits-rings, blades, relics-Princess Elira harbors a deadly secret: she doesn't need one. Her power lives in her blood, in her bones... and in her mind. A rare, raw gift no one else possesses. And a curse she must never reveal. Because every time she uses it, something inside her breaks. In the shadows of the capital's underworld, Kallan-a bound courier turned ruthless broker-has heard whispers of conduitless magic. The kind that can topple thrones. He doesn't care who it belongs to-he only wants to control it, leverage it, and finally break free of the chains that bind him. But the source of that power isn't a myth. She's the crown's hidden daughter. When Kallan uncovers Elira's secret, he sees an opportunity. She sees a threat. But in a world where trust is rare and betrayal is currency, neither of them can walk away. Forced into an uneasy alliance, they begin a slow, dangerous dance of secrets, survival-and something else neither of them expected. Because Kallan might be the only one who sees Elira not as a weapon, but as a person. And Elira might be the only one who can save him. But when Kallan's life hangs in the balance, Elira must choose: keep the darkness at bay-or save him and lose herself to it. The girl who never wanted a crown may soon wear one woven from shadows.
